MINUTES <br />EugeneCityCouncil <br />HarrisHall,125East8Avenue <br />th <br />Eugene,Oregon97401 <br />October10,2016 <br />7:30p.m. <br />CouncilorsPresent: <br />#« ¨±¤3¸±¤³³µ¨ ¯§®¤ <br />CouncilorsAbsent: <br /> CEREMONIAL MATTERS <br />1. <br />Mayor Piercy honored the Eugene Emeralds baseball team for being the 2016 Northwest League <br />Champions. <br />The City of Eugene Urban Forestry program was awarded the Oregon Community Trees 2016 <br />Organizational Award. <br />Judge Mary Jane Mori was recognized for her 22 years as a Municipal Court Judge for the City of <br />Eugene and it was announced that a courtroom will be named the “Mary Jane Mori Courtroom.” <br />2. PUBLIC FORUM <br /> 1. Gail Newton – Supported enhanced swimming pool access in Eugene. <br /> 2. Jeff Winter – Supported more swimming access in Eugene and a cover for Amazon pool. <br /> 3. Paul Neville – Supported approval of HOME funds for St. Vincent de Paul housing for teens. <br /> 4. Queen Eugenia Slimesworth – Supported bringing back the Eugene Celebration parade. <br /> 5. Alden McWayne – Supported implementation of the climate recovery ordinance. <br /> 6. Wes Georgiev – Supported allocating money to the Transportation System Plan for Beltline Rd. <br /> 7. Corina MacWilliams – Supported implantation of the climate recovery ordinance and carbon tax. <br /> 8. Alfredo Gormezano – Supported helping homeowners to construct extra dwellings on property. <br /> 9. Stefan Strek – Supported community consent on projects in Eugene. <br /> 10. Joe Tyndall – Said he believes the Police Commission is censoring information. <br />Council discussion: <br />Dakota Access Pipeline resolution is to be recognized on Indigenous Peoples Day. <br />Excited for the potential of a cover for Amazon Pool. <br />St. Vincent de Paul application received some of the highest scores ever by HUD. <br />3.
